Please help keep this Site Going

Menopausal Mother Nature

News about Climate Change and our Planet


Yakutia June 26 2022 Permafrost Extreme weather +33 ° C People chill and have fun on the glacier

Yes, you are

A glacier forms on land. (Ground)

Permafrost is essentially frozen layers beneath land.

Melting permafrost + warmer air = melting glacier

Edit: if you’re confused on how the land beneath a cold glacier can melt, give this a read:


Please help keep this Site Going